The Goethe Certificate: A Gateway to German Language Proficiency
The Goethe Certificate, also called the Goethe-Zertifikat, is an internationally recognized certification that evaluates and accredits efficiency in the German language. Administered by the Goethe-Institut, the world's biggest German cultural company, these certificates are developed to offer a standardized step of German language skills for various levels, from novices to sophisticated speakers. What is the Goethe Certificate?
The Goethe Certificate is a series of language efficiency tests that align with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). The CEFR is a framework used to explain language ability on a six-point scale, ranging from A1 (novice) to C2 (proficiency). The Goethe Certificate is acknowledged by universities, employers, and federal governments worldwide, making it a valuable asset for anybody looking to show their German language abilities.
Levels of the Goethe Certificate
The Goethe Certificate is divided into several levels, each corresponding to a particular CEFR level:

Goethe-Zertifikat A1: Start Deutsch 1
Description: This certificate is designed for newbies and validates that the holder can interact in easy and routine jobs requiring a basic and direct exchange of information.Abilities: Understanding and using familiar daily expressions, fundamental phrases, and presenting oneself and others.
Goethe-Zertifikat A2: Start Deutsch 2
Description: This level validates that the holder can understand sentences and often used expressions associated to locations of the majority of immediate relevance (e.g., personal and household details, shopping, local location, work).Abilities: Communicating in simple and regular jobs, explaining in easy terms aspects of their background, immediate environment, and matters in areas of immediate requirement.
Goethe-Zertifikat B1
Description: This certificate validates that the holder can comprehend the main points of clear standard input on familiar matters regularly encountered in work, school, leisure, etc.Skills: Dealing with most circumstances likely to emerge while traveling in a German-speaking area, and producing basic linked text on subjects that recognize or of individual interest.
Goethe-Zertifikat B2
Description: This level verifies that the holder can comprehend the primary concepts of complex text on both concrete and abstract topics, consisting of technical conversations in his/her field of expertise.Abilities: Interacting with a degree of fluency and spontaneity that makes routine interaction with native speakers quite possible without stress for either party, and producing clear, in-depth text on a large range of subjects.
Goethe-Zertifikat C1
Description: This certificate verifies that the holder can understand a vast array of demanding, longer texts and acknowledge implicit meaning.Skills: Expressing him/herself with complete confidence and spontaneously without much obvious looking for expressions, and utilizing language flexibly and efficiently for social, academic, and expert functions.
Goethe-Zertifikat C2: Großes Deutsches Sprachdiplom

The Goethe Certificate examinations are developed to assess all 4 language abilities: reading, composing, listening, and speaking. Each level has a specific format and period, but usually, the exams include:

Q: How long does it require to prepare for the Goethe Certificate?A: The preparation time varies depending on the person's beginning level and the level they are aiming for. Typically, it can take a number of months to a year of constant study.

Q: Can I take the Goethe Certificate exam online?A: Yes, the Goethe-Institut uses online variations of a few of its tests. Nevertheless, the accessibility and format might differ, so it's finest to inspect the official website for the most current info.
